Direction: Read the given information carefully and answer the questions given beside:
Six boxes are placed one above the other in a rack. The lowermost rack is numbered as one and above is two and so on. Each box has different number of balls.
Box P is placed immediately above Box R. Only one box is placed between the boxes having 175 and 165 balls. Box U has 210 balls. Box L is placed above Box M but neither of the boxes is placed in the topmost rack. Box which has 119 balls is placed immediately above the box which has 190 balls. Three boxes are placed between Box R and the box has 180 balls. Box which has 175 balls is placed immediately above the box, which has 180 balls. Two boxes are placed between the box which has 190 balls and Box K.


1. What is the average number of balls in the boxes, which are placed in even numbered racks ?
A. 168 balls B. 158 balls C. 153 balls D. 164 balls E. None of these


2. Which among the following statements is true ?
A. Only one box is placed between Box M and the box which has 175 balls.


B. Box U and the box which has 165 balls are placed not adjacent to each other.
C. The box which has 180 balls is placed immediately above the box which has 165 balls.
D. No boxes are placed between the box P and Box L. E. None is true


3. In certain way Box P is related to 119 balls, Box L is related to 165 balls and in same way, which among the following box is related to 180 balls ?
A. Box M B. Box U C. Box R D. Box P E. None of these


4. If box O is placed immediate above of box P then box O is placed in which number rack ?
A. Fifth B. Ninth C. Seventh D. Sixth E. None of these


5. Box K has how many balls in it ?
A. 175 B. 119 C. 190 D. 210 E. None of these


Answers :
1. Following the common explanation, we get "153 balls".
Even numbered racks: 2nd rack-Box K-175 balls, 4th rack-Box L-165 balls & 6th rack-Box P-119 balls
Sum = 175 + 165 + 119 = 459 balls
Average = 459 balls / 3 = 153 balls
Option C is correct.
2. Following the common explanation, we get "None is true".
Option E is correct.
3. Following the common explanation, we get "Box M has 180 balls".
Relation: Box P has 119 balls and Box L has 165 balls
Similarly, Box M has 180 balls
Option A is correct.
4. Following the common explanation, we get "Box O will placed in Seventh rack". Option C is correct.
5. Following the common explanation, we get "Box K has 175 balls in it". Option A is correct.


SET – 2
Certain number of boxes are placed one above the other. Some of the boxes have different number of balls. No two boxes have same number of balls.
There are four boxes between Box W and Box T, which at the topmost position. Two boxes are placed between Box W and Box V. One box is placed between Box V and Box Q, which has 12 balls. One box is placed between Box R and Box Q. Box placed immediately below of Box V contains one ball more than Box S. Two boxes are placed between Box R and Box S. Box S is not placed immediately below of the box, which has even numbered balls. Box S has 9 balls. Maximum ten boxes are placed one above the other. At least one box is there between topmost box and Box S.


6. How many boxes are there in the arrangement ?
A. Ten B. Nine C. Seven D. Eight E. Can't be determined


7. How many boxes are placed between Box T and Box S ?
A. None B. Four C. Six D. Eight E. Can’t be determined


8. What is the position of Box Q with respect to Box S ?
A. Fifth to the above B. Fifth to the below C. Fourth to the below D. Either A or B E. Either B or C


9. If Box L is placed immediately above Box E, then which among following statement is true ?
A. Two boxes are placed between Box Q and Box L.
B. Number of boxes below Box L is same as above Box V.
C. More than one box is placed between Box W and Box E.
D. Box E and the box, which has 9 balls are adjacent to each other.
E. All of these


10. If the ratio of balls in Box Q and Box R is 1 : 2 respectively and the sum of the balls in Box S and Box W is 27, then what is the difference between the balls in Box R and Box W ?
A. 12 balls B. 18 balls C. 6 balls D. 24 balls E. Can't be determined


Answers :
6. Following the common explanation, we get "Ten Boxes". Option A is correct.
7. Following the common explanation, we get "8 boxes are placed between Box T and Box S".Option D is correct.
8. Following the common explanation, we get "Box Q is 5th to the above Box S". Option A is correct.
9. Following the common explanation, we get "All of these". All the given statements are true.
As per question, Box L and Box E are placed at 3rd and 2nd position from bottom. Option E is Correct. 


10. Following the common explanation, we get "6 balls". We know Box Q = 12 balls and Box S = 9 From question, Box R = (2/1) × Box Q = 2 × 12 = 24 balls


Box S + Box W = 27 balls , Box W = 27 – 9 = 18 balls , Difference Box R – Box W = 24 – 18 = 6 balls. Option C is Correct.


SET – 3
Nine sweet boxes are arranged in racks, one above the other. Each sweet box has different weight such as 230g, 170g, 360g, 510g, 340g, 720g, 550g, 690g and 460g. Each box is differentiated with different color such as Green, White, Black, Orange, Pink, Grey, Red, Yellow and Blue. All the above information is not necessarily in the same order.
Number of box below the Box which is 340g and above the box which is 170g is same. Only two boxes are placed between Red box and Green box. Blue box is above Green box and only one box is placed between them. There are as many boxes between Green box and Orange box as between Pink box and Black box. Pink box's weight is equal to the sum of the weight of Blue box and Red box. The weight of White box is less than Yellow box and more than Orange box. The Red box and Black box is arranged in the adjacent racks. Number of boxes placed between White box and Grey box is twice the number of box placed between Yellow box and White box. Red box is placed below the Blue box. Yellow Box is not placed above the Blue box. Weight of Green box is ten grams more than the twice of Grey box. Red box is not placed in the lower most rack. More than one box is placed below the Black box. The weight of the Black box is three times the weight of Blue box. The Grey box's weight is two-third of weight of Black box. Box which have the weight of 230g and 340g are in the adjacent racks.


11. What is the difference between the weights of the box having minimum weight and the Orange box ?(in grams)
A. 180 B. 290 C. 320 D. 230 E. None of these


12. Which of the following combinations is true ?
A. Orange-690g B. Red-510g C. Pink-170g D. Grey-340g E. All are true


13. Which of the following colored sweet boxes has the maximum weight ?
A. White B. Pink C. Black D. Orange E. Yellow


14. What is the average weight (in gm) of Green, Blue and Yellow sweet boxes ?


A. 440 B. 990 C. 630 D. 490 E. None of these


15. How many sweet boxes are placed between the box weighing 230g and the box weighing 510g ?
A. One B. Two C. Three D. Four E. Either two or three


Answers :
11. Following the common explanation, we get "290 grams". Weight of Orange box is 460g and weight of Blue box i.e. box with minimum weight is 170 g.
Thus required difference is 290g. Option B is correct.
12. The following common explanation, we get "Grey box-340 grams". Option D is correct.
13. The following common explanation, we get "Pink box - 720 grams" Otion B is correct.


14. The following common explanation, we get "440". Green = 690g, Blue = 170g, Yellow = 460g then Average = [690 + 170 + 460]/3 = 1320/3 = 440g. Option A is correct.
15. The following common explanation, we get "Two Boxes". Option B is correct.


SET – 4
Nine boxes named A, B, C, D, E, F, G, H and I are placed one above other but not necessarily in the same order. Only five boxes are placed between A and C. E is placed immediate above C. Only three boxes are placed between E and D. Number of boxes placed between A and D is same as between B and E. F is placed below B, but not at bottom. Not less than four boxes are placed between E and F. One box is placed between F and G. Box I is placed above box H.


16. How many boxes are placed between I and F ?
A. None B. 1 C. 2 D. 3 E. Can't be determined


17. E is related to G in a way, F is related to I in the same way then which of the following is related to C in the same way ?
A. G B. B C. A D. D E. H


18. What is the position of I with respect to B ?
A. 2 boxes below B. 1 box below C. 4 boxes above D. Immediate above E. Can't be determined


19. Which of the following boxes is placed exactly in the middle ?
A. C B. D C. G D. F E. None of these


20. Which of the following boxes is placed immediately above and immediately below B ?
A. I and D B. I and C C. C and E D. E and G E. None of these


Answers :
16. 3 boxes are placed between I and F. Option D is correct.
17. E is related to G in a way that their positions from top and bottom are same, similarly F is related to I, in the same way A is related to C.
Option C is correct.
18. I is placed immediate above B. Option D is correct.
19. D is placed exactly in the middle. Option B is correct.
20. I and D are placed immediately above and immediately below B. Option A is correct.
